I have sold my 2019 Active Auto with 182000 km on.
5 x v belt tensioners replaced, front brakes x 2, rear brakes x 2 ( told the auto hold uses those rear brakes ). Averaged 9.4 l over duration of having vehicle. Battery once.

Pity you struggle to get the original Geolander tyres ( 17 inch ) , really gave good mileage.

LIkes :

Service plan
Drive

Not so much :

- Infotainment ( really should let you choose whether you wanna use touch screen or dial. I prefer dial, but passengers might wanna use touchscreen
- Auto levelling lights. Just give us a dial to manually adjust. I went through so much hassle adjusting left light manually with screwdriver to be a little higher than right so that I can have enough visibility and not get flashed by oncoming drivers.
- NA engine

Dislike

Gearbox and gear ratios especially 4 to 5. Revs drop to much between 4 and 5, resulting in vehicle kinda going from 6 to 4 with cruise control on.

So I have done 8000 km with the new car. V belt tensioner still quiet, which is the most I have done without it making a noise.
My observations so far, vs previous model.
Aircon : minimum seems to be 3 degrees higher than on previous model.
Font on infotainment seems to be a little bigger.
